Sr Data Modeler Fort Worth, TX, 76102 bvseeking a Senior Data Modeler to join our Data Engineering team. Our group is a highly technical mix of engineers, analysts, and architects focused on building high-quality, scalable, and repeatable data solutions. We partner with business units across the company to deliver trusted data that powers both day-to-day healthcare operations and advanced analytics-ultimately helping more people get the medicines they need to live healthier lives. What You'll Do: The Sr. Data Modeler will design, develop, and maintain data models that support transactional systems (FHIR/canonical models, operational data stores, interoperability) and analytical environments (data warehouses, data marts, BI dashboards, and advanced analytics platforms). You'll ensure data is structured efficiently to enable real-time operational workflows as well as large-scale analytical insights.

Responsibilities: Design and implement conceptual, logical, and physical data models for both transactional healthcare applications and analytical/reporting use cases. Develop and maintain FHIR-aligned and canonical data models to support interoperability, patient/provider/drug mastering, and integration with FHIR servers. Design and optimize analytical models (dimensional, wide-table, Data Vault) that power dashboards, self-service analytics, and AI/ML workloads. Partner with product engineering, DBAs, data engineers, and business analysts to translate business requirements into scalable data architecture. Support ETL/ELT and real-time data pipelines to ensure efficient integration, transformation, and availability across operational and analytical layers. Conduct data profiling, lineage analysis, and quality checks to ensure models deliver trusted, consistent information. Document metadata, data dictionaries, and lineage across both transactional and analytical domains. Apply data governance and compliance best practices to meet regulatory requirements (HIPAA, SOX, GDPR, etc.) Skills You'll Need: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, or related field. 7+ years of technical and professional experience. 5+ years of hands-on data modeling and database design experience, ideally in healthcare. Experience in FHIR (Fast Healthcare Interoperability Resources) and HL7 standards for transactional healthcare data preferred. Strong knowledge of analytical modeling (dimensional/star schema, Data Vault, warehouse/lakehouse environments). Experience with ETL/ELT processes and modern data pipeline development. Familiarity with data governance, lineage, and compliance requirements in healthcare.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with excellent attention to detail. Preferred Skills: Experience with cloud-based healthcare data platforms (Azure, GCP, AWS, Databricks, Snowflake, etc.). Working knowledge of modern data catalogs, metadata tools, and security frameworks. Ability to balance operational and analytical priorities in data design.
